Hey I know this might get be a long shot but does anyone have any reloading data for .450-400 NE for north fork bullets?
 
f you have, or can get your hands on, African Dangerous Game Cartridges by Pierre van der Walt you will find pages of consolidated, attributed loads for the express cartridges. Worth the investment if you can find a copy.
 
Everything in the previously mentioned book is irrelevant when it comes to North Fork bullets,.....Aside from the safe powders to use in any given Nitro Double, which appear to be in this country RL15 and H4350. If you use the nitro conversion formula that gives you a pretty good starting point. I faced the same situation loading for an old english double and NF bullets, but I have a supply of Woodleighs that are dialed in so I abandoned NF. I will say because of the design of NF they take more powder charge to get to needed velocity.

If your rifle is 450-400 3" I wrote the following in a previous post about regulation loads:

In my Merkel 140AE, the Hornady DGX factory load shoots about 2040 fps, but varies from 2000 fps in near freezing temperatures to 2080 fps in hot temperatures. There is also a difference of about 30 fps between the two barrels. My rifle regulates well at 50M with the Hornady factory load.

The Woodleigh 400 gr. SP regulates well with 80 grains of IMR 4831, Fed 215M primer @ 2010 fps. Increasing the charge to 81 grains of IMR 4831 yielded about 2100 fps. and slightly more open groups.

If substituting Hodgdon 4831, my rifle requires 83-83.5 gr. of powder & Fed 215M primer for similar velocity and group size.

When loading the North fork Cup Point Solid, or the Woodleigh Solid, I drop down to 81 gr. of H4831.
